This cruise ship's itinerary includes the following: 1st Day: Depart from Kampong Khleang at 7:30 AM. After breakfast, visit the floating village of Chong Khneas, and anchor in front Kampong Khleang village. Visit with community vessels from the fishing village on stilts. At 4 PM, anchor near Pean Bang and visit the floating forest near the boat and the village. Dinner is served by 7:30 PM on board. 2nd Day: Depart from Chnnok Tru. Visit the floating villages of Chhnok Tru and Kompong Preas. After lunch, arrive at Kampong Chhnang to visit pottery village and mooring in front of a typical vegetable farm. Dinner is served by 7:30 PM on board. 3rd Day: After breakfast, the boat anchors along the river banks in Oudong. Departure by Tuk-Tuk to the hill of Oudong. Back on board at 12.45 PM for lunch, then arrive at tourist port in the center of Phnom Penh by 3:30 PM. Please note: The itinerary may change from early February to late June. Please be advised that this property is a cruise and not a standard hotel. Guests board the ship at Chong Kneas Port in Siem Reap.
